Crawley Borough Council is pleased to confirm that preparatory works for phase one of the Station Gateway regeneration scheme are now underway, with construction expected to continue for approximately five months.

The works, which are being carried out by Landbuild Ltd on behalf of Crawley Borough Council, will transform the public spaces on the Martlets, Haslett Avenue West, and Friary Way, and deliver major improvements to the operation of the bus station in the heart of Crawley town centre.

The first phase of construction will focus on highway improvements along Station Way and the junction with Friary Way, including upgraded pedestrian routes, improved traffic flow and enhanced public spaces.

To carry out the works safely and efficiently, lane closures will be required at various stages and occasional full road closures may be necessary. Clearly signed diversion routes will be put in place accordingly and access for residents and local businesses will be maintained throughout. These measures have been carefully planned to minimise disruption wherever possible.
